SVR -

I talked to SVR and was told that they mentioned in conf call that expense trends in April were unexpectedly higher and that they would need to review it and then give guidance on Q2 and rest-of-year. That is the reason for downgrade.

They have stockholders meeting next tuesday and expect to have the review wrapped up and will issue press release if anything material needs to be said. Was told sales are OK but expenses are up.
